Key Considerations (Technical):

AEC-Q100 Qualification: Mandatory. Verify the MCU is AEC-Q100 qualified for the intended automotive application (temperature range, stress tests, etc.). Request documentation before ordering. Don't accept "compliant" – demand the report*.

Peripheral Set: CAN, LIN, SPI, UART, ADC, DAC – ensure the MCU includes all* necessary peripherals for your application. Consider future expansion needs.
